Construction and Features
The PVC spiral steel wire reinforced hose is primarily composed of polyvinyl chloride (PVC) and incorporates a spiral steel wire for added strength and durability. The combination of these materials results in a hose that is flexible, lightweight, and resistant to various environmental factors. The PVC resin provides excellent chemical resistance, making it suitable for handling a wide range of fluids, including water, oils, and chemicals.
The spiral steel wire reinforcement enhances the hose's structural integrity, preventing kinking and crushing under pressure. This feature allows for consistent performance even in demanding conditions, making it a preferred choice for both industrial and agricultural uses.
Applications
The applications of PVC spiral steel wire reinforced hoses are vast and varied. In agriculture, they are commonly used for irrigation systems, where water needs to be transported efficiently over long distances. Additionally, these hoses are utilized in the transfer of fertilizers and pesticides, providing farmers with a reliable means to deliver essential nutrients to their crops.
In industrial settings, the versatility of these hoses shines through. They are often employed in the construction, mining, and manufacturing sectors, where they facilitate the transportation of air, water, and various chemicals. Their durability against abrasion and wear also means they are ideal for high-pressure applications.
Benefits
One of the primary benefits of PVC spiral steel wire reinforced hoses is their flexibility. Unlike traditional rubber hoses, they can bend and maneuver around tight corners without losing performance. This characteristic not only allows for easier handling but also enables users to optimize space during storage and transportation.
Moreover, the combination of PVC and steel wire makes these hoses resistant to environmental factors such as UV rays, ozone, and extreme temperatures. This longevity reduces the need for frequent replacements, translating to cost savings for businesses over time.
